How does the whole house instant hot water circulator work?
The comfort system pump is installed on your existing hot water heater “hot water line”. The system puts hot water in the hot water line instantly, using a pump with a built-in timer at the water heater and a patented bypass valve at the point of use. Comfort valve installed under the farthest faucet from the water heater.

How much water is saved by instant hot water?
Whichever instant hot water option you choose, you could end up conserving as much as 11,000 to 16,000 gallons of water each year. Moreover, by speeding up the delivery of hot water, you’re likely to see a positive difference in your utility bills.

How does instant hot water heater work?
An Instant Flow Water Heater heats the water as it flows through the unit. The electric heater provides heat to the tubes within the unit. These tubes are filled with water and as the water flows through, it becomes heated. This provides you with hot water in an instant.
What is instantaneous hot water heater?
Tankless water heaters-also called instantaneous, continuous flow, inline, flash, on-demand, or instant-on water heaters are water heaters that instantly heat water as it flows through the device, and do not retain any water internally except for what is in the heat exchanger coil.
How long does water heater last on average?
A water heater’s useful life varies, depending on the type of water heater, the quality of the unit, and how well it’s been maintained. A traditional tank-type water heater lasts an average of eight to 12 years.
What is instantaneous hot water system?
An instantaneous gas hot water system has a range of names, including: Tankless gas hot water system; Continuous flow gas hot water system; On-demand gas hot water system; They are generally quite small and are located on the wall, heating water as needed instead of heating and then storing. They are also one of the most efficient, if not the most efficient, hot water systems available.
